Mukesh Kumar released from India squad, Bengal pacer to feature in Ranji Trophy match vs Bihar in Kolkata

Mukesh Kumar was released from the squad before the third Test against England in Rajkot. The 30-year-old pacer will now play a Ranji Trophy 2023-24 match for Bengal against Bihar from February 16 in Kolkata.

''Mr Mukesh Kumar has been released from the India squad for the third Test against England in Rajkot, the BCCI said in a statement ''He will join his Ranji Trophy team, Bengal, for the team's next fixture before linking up with Team India in Ranchi,'' it added.

Akash Deep, a second pacer from Bengal was added in India squad for the final three Tests against England. However, he did not get to make his India debut on Thursday.

Mukesh Kumar was replaced by Mohammed Siraj in the India playing eleven for the third Test of the five-match series against England. The Bihar-born pacer was hammered for 44 runs in seven overs in the first innings of the second Test in Vizag. He managed to take a wicket in the second innings, but again leaked 26 runs in five overs. His sole wicket was that of England number 10 Shoaib Bashir

Mohammed Siraj was rested from the second Test to manage his workload management. Against the rumours suggesting that Jasprit Bumrah would be rested in Rajkot, the pacer spearhead was named in the playing eleven for the third consecutive time in the series.

Ravindra Jadeja also returned from his injury to feature in the third Test. Further, Kuldeep Yadav was picked ahead of Axar Patel as the third spinner alongside Jadeja and Ashwin. Sarfaraz Khan and Dhruv Jurel made their India debut at the Niranjan Shah Stadium in Rajkot.

The fourth Test between India and England will be played in Ranchi from February 23. The final Test will be held in Dharamsala from March 7.
